WebMay 3, 2024 · The buyers claimed in a January 2024 class action lawsuit that BodyArmor markets its sports drink as healthy despite one bottle containing 36 grams of sugar. The original class action lawsuit was dismissed in June 2024 but was later amended to include the fruit juice labeling claims.
